    About Us

    Block Institute supports individ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ities in building lives of independence, connection, and belonging. For more than 60 years, we have partnered with individuals and families to provide services that foster growth, meaningful relationships, and opportunities for active participation in community life.

    Our mission: Empowering lives to thrive.

    As part of an upcoming rebrand, we are launching a new website and are seeking a copywriter to help shape clear, engaging, and thoughtful content that reflects our work.

    Role Overview

    This role will lead the writing and refinement of website content within a 4–6-week project timeline. It will involve translating complex program information into clear, compelling language while maintaining a consistent voice across the site.

    Scope of Work

      • Write and refine content for core website pages (e.g., Home, About, Programs, Services, Careers)
      • Edit and polish secondary pages (e.g., Leadership, Contact, FAQs)
      • Align content with brand voice, tone, and messaging direction
      • Simplify complex information into clear, user-friendly language
      •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to gather input and feedback
      • Participate in a kickoff call and stakeholder interviews
      • Complete at least 2 rounds of revisions per page

    Qualifications

    • Proven experience writing website copy (portfolio or writing samples required)
    • Exceptional writing skills with a focus on clarity, tone, and precision
    • Strong editing skills and attention to detail
    • Excellent communication and interviewing skills
    • Ability to manage feedback and deliver high-quality work within a defined timeline
    • Experience writing for mission-driven organizations (nonprofits, healthcare, education, or human services) preferred

    Nice to Have

      • Experience supporting a rebrand or website redesign
      • Experience with accessible and inclusive writing practices
      • Familiarity with SEO and web content structure
